Synopsis: nvi loses edited file on network disconnection State-Changed-From-To: suspended->feedback State-Changed-By: edwin State-Changed-When: Thu Aug 7 01:59:33 UTC 2008 State-Changed-Why: I've tried several ways to reproduce it (on 7.0), but up to so far I always managed to get it back, except in one case (described below) What could have happened is that while you were editing, you saved the temporary message in the location elm specified ($HOME/tmp/foo most likely), you started a new line but didn't press escape yet to indicate the end of the current input. So the file should still be available in the temporary location elm had specified. Can I close this PR? http://www.freebsd.org/cgi/query-pr.cgi?pr=83195help
